Crunchy buffalo by Brilliant-Ant-6853 in Wings

[–]Ru4pigsizedelephants 1 point2 points  (0 children)

I double fry but my first fry is at a lower temp, like 275-300. Then I like to pop em in my chest freezer for 15-20 minutes before frying the second time at 375-400.

The saucing thing is tricky but letting them cool just a bit helps, like others have said.

I don't notice much difference dry brining them or anything when I'm deep frying. For smoking meat or getting a great sear on a steak, sure, but I believe it's a waste of time when frying.
